icon of Kaiko

Kaiko

Kaiko is an enterprise-grade provider of crypto market data, analytics, and index services designed for financial institutions, asset managers, exchanges, and crypto-native businesses. The company aggregates highly granular on-chain and off-chain market data, delivers it through multiple distribution channels, and provides proprietary analytics for fair market valuation, best execution, and risk management. Kaiko also offers trusted index services, benchmark rates, and calculation agent support to enable compliant financial products like ETFs and derivatives. With SOC-2 Type II certification, EU BMR compliance, and 24/7 integration support, Kaiko emphasizes reliability, regulatory alignment, and seamless onboarding for mission-critical workflows across front, mid, and back offices.

Introduction

Overview

Kaiko is a specialist provider of digital-asset market data, analytics, monitoring, and index services built for enterprise use. The platform aggregates and normalizes market and on-chain data across networks and venues to power trading, risk management, regulatory reporting, valuation, and product structuring. Kaiko positions itself as a trusted partner for financial institutions and crypto-native firms that require compliant, high-quality data and robust delivery options.

Core Capabilities
  1. High-Fidelity Data Feeds: Kaiko provides level 1 and level 2 market data, order book snapshots, trade ticks, and historical time-series across centralized exchanges and decentralized venues. These feeds are designed for both front-office trading systems and mid/back-office reconciliation and analytics.

  2. Proprietary Analytics: Kaiko offers analytics solutions such as Best Execution pricing, Fair Market Value calculations, portfolio- and derivatives-focused risk metrics, and derivatives risk indicators. These tools help firms mark positions, measure execution quality, and model exposure in volatile markets.

  3. Monitoring & Surveillance: The platform includes market monitoring products for surveillance, AML/CFT, and market integrity checks. Kaiko’s monitoring suite is useful for regulators, exchanges, and compliance teams seeking automated detection of market abuse and irregular activity.

  4. Indices & Benchmark Services: Kaiko Indices delivers reference rates, multi-asset indices, and calculation agent services for listed products, ETFs, and structured notes. Indices are built to be compliant and auditable, supporting clients that need formal benchmark infrastructure.

  5. On-Chain and Infrastructure Tools: Kaiko provides on-chain monitoring, distribution infrastructure (including oracle and oracle-complementary services), instrument explorers, and developer documentation for integration. These capabilities ensure broad coverage across both centralized and decentralized data sources.

Integration, Delivery, and Compliance

Kaiko emphasizes seamless delivery through a variety of distribution channels and strong integration support. The company advertises 24/7 global onboarding assistance and multiple delivery formats tailored to enterprise needs. Kaiko highlights compliance credentials such as SOC-2 Type II certification and EU BMR alignment, which are critical for institutional clients looking to use crypto data in regulated reporting, valuations, and custody workflows.

Use Cases and Target Users

Kaiko’s products are relevant for: trading desks seeking granular market data and execution analytics; asset managers and custodians requiring compliant valuation and reference rates; exchanges and issuers needing calculation agent and index services; and compliance teams needing surveillance and AML tooling. The platform also supports research teams and quant groups with comprehensive historical datasets and developer APIs.
